“This revolutionary shift in manufacturing
philosophy will allow for significant cost reductions and hence will allow
manufacturers to expand current products into new markets and develop entirely
new, economically viable products such as flexible displays, printed circuit
boards, smart packaging, membrane keyboards, touch screens, RFID tags, EAS tags
and sensors,” adds Dr. John Mills, VP of Technology, Plastic Logic LTD and
Co-Chair (e-mail protected from spam bots).
IMI’s 4th Annual Printable
Electronics and Displays Conference & Trade Fair will represent all critical
materials, printing and device technologies in this rapidly emerging field.
Areas which will be addressed include printing conductors, semiconductors,
dielectrics and resistors, ink jet, offset lithographic and flexographic
printing as well as device manufacturing applications such as printed circuit
boards, RFID tags, displays, sensors, smart packaging and membrane keyboards.
